Does this settlement apply to your? In earlier times, simply into the-time money generated into lead finance having fun with earnings-driven installment preparations or standard 10-year payment preparations mentioned to the PSLF.

Here’s what is completely new: The fresh new service have a tendency to retroactively matter your previous repayments into the the 120-commission significance of PSLF, although they certainly were generated with the completely wrong mortgage sorts of otherwise for the completely wrong fee bundle. This means the loan payments Commonly count, even if you produced those people earlier in the day repayments towards:

Latest otherwise prior Government Members of the family Studies Loans; or Graduated or any other sorts of percentage agreements that did not previously count. Other types of money, eg earlier rolling later costs, will also amount.

Even though you was basically denied PSLF in the past Otherwise their financing servicer told you that you payday loans ID do not meet the requirements, under so it settlement, the job will be reconsidered

The state Panel for Teacher Degree (SBEC) a week ago provided first acceptance so you can regulations pertaining to offer abandonment and products around hence educators will get resign regarding a jobs bargain instead punishment. Specifically, the rules use HB 2519, published by Representative. Drew Darby, to support less sanctions to own coaches resigning anywhere between 30 and you will forty five months prior to the first day from instruction. Patty Quinzi, Colorado AFT legislative counsel, testified in support of the principles, which allow the SBEC to take on mitigating things novel to each and every case.

Virtual observations Pursuing the start of pandemic, SBEC observed short-term legislation permitting virtual findings off educator preparation system (EPP) candidates carrying out their fieldwork. Although not, a rules pushed from the getting-funds EPP company today forever enables digital findings in place of a call at-people observance if for example the virtual observance try “equivalent during the rigor” so you can an in-person observation. SBEC’s proposed laws and regulations with the legislation generate no tech conditions to help you carry out digital observations and make certain equivalence.
